Fort Liberté is a hidden gem along the northern coast of Haiti that beckons travelers with its rich history and charming scenery. As a former military outpost, the town boasts fascinating architecture, with remnants of colonial-era buildings standing alongside colorful local homes. Visitors can explore the narrow cobblestone streets that wind through the town, offering glimpses into daily life in this tranquil setting. The serene beaches nearby provide a perfect escape, where you can relax on golden sands or take a refreshing dip in the crystal-clear waters of the Caribbean Sea. One of the highlights of Fort Liberté is the historical significance of the area, where you can visit sites that tell the story of Haiti's past. The nearby Fort de la Liberté, a historic fortress, offers panoramic views of the surrounding landscape and is a great spot for photography enthusiasts. You might also encounter local markets bustling with activity, where you can savor authentic Haitian cuisine and purchase handmade crafts that embody the local culture. As you explore Fort Liberté, you'll be enveloped in the warm hospitality of the locals, who are eager to share their traditions and stories. The town's vibrant atmosphere, combined with its picturesque surroundings, makes it an ideal destination for those looking to immerse themselves in the heart and soul of Haiti. Whether you're an adventurer or a culture seeker, Fort Liberté promises a memorable experience filled with discovery and delight.

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ving from Cap-Haïtien, take Route Nationale 1 (RN1) south. After approximately 35 km, take the exit toward Fort Liberté and follow the signs. The drive should take around 45 minutes depending on traffic. Once you arrive in Fort Liberté, navigate towards the center of the city until you reach the address M5G5+6F5.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Fort Liberté by public transportation, start by taking a tap-tap (shared taxi) from Cap-Haïtien to Fort Liberté. Tap-taps leave from various points in Cap-Haïtien and the fare is usually about 50 HTG. The journey will take approximately 1 hour. Once you arrive in Fort Liberté, ask the driver or locals for directions to M5G5+6F5, which is located in the center of town.
